Encouraging Children to Read

15 February, 2013 | By Goldie Alexander

This week I came across 2 interesting ways of encouraging children to read. The first perhaps is more about becoming computer literate at an astonishingly early age. I was introduced to a girl playing on her mother’s iPad bringing up nursery rhymes, songs and stories. The baby already knew hoe to move pages, increase volume (after the mother turned it down) and what characters she wanted to focus on. Not bad for a nineteen month old baby.

The second was I thought a splendid way of mother daughter/son bonding that would also encourage reading. Given the popularity of book clubs, a mother and her ten year old belonged to the same club where  both the child and the mother read the same book and all exchanged views when the participants got together.
